[2010-03-11 12:43:23] fatih dot ustundag at gmail dot com

I am using Ubuntu 9.10 Turkish for development. output of "locale" is :

LANG=tr_TR.UTF-8
LC_CTYPE="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_NUMERIC="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_TIME="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_COLLATE="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_MONETARY="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_MESSAGES="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_PAPER="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_NAME="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_ADDRESS="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_TELEPHONE="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_MEASUREMENT="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_IDENTIFICATION="tr_TR.UTF-8"
LC_ALL=


If I compile php 5.3.2 with this locale, I get same error. But, before make 

export LC_ALL=en_US.UTF-8

solved problem. I think problem is about turkish char "ı","İ"
